Market Analysis
San Marcos' condo market reflects a unique blend of suburban charm and urban convenience. Nestled between the picturesque hills of Woodland Park and the bustling San Marcos Village, condos here attract a diverse range of buyers. The steady influx of families and young professionals is driven by the highly-rated San Marcos Unified School District and proximity to major highways like the 78 and 15. Given the area's growth and ongoing developments, it's not unusual to see new projects popping up, particularly near CSU San Marcos. This vibrant community is appealing for both end-users and investors, making it a dynamic market worth exploring.
Price Insights
While condo prices can vary significantly based on location and amenities, many properties in neighborhoods like Rancho Dorado and Santa Fe Hills tend to provide great value. For example, a cozy two-bedroom unit on Via Vera Cruz may range from mid to high price points, but you often get more for your money here than in some parts of coastal San Diego. The recent trend has been toward increased demand for lower-maintenance living spaces, particularly as remote work becomes more prevalent. Investors may find that properties in sought-after areas close to shopping centers like San Marcos Plaza might offer advantageous appreciation rates over time.

Location Highlights
Living in San Marcos means enjoying a wealth of local attractions. The stunning Double Peak Park on Double Peak Drive offers breathtaking views and extensive trails, perfect for outdoor enthusiasts. For families, the area's highly-rated schools, such as San Elijo Middle School, have made it an attractive destination. Shopping is a breeze, with places like Target and the Grand Plaza shopping center just around the corner, providing everything from groceries to chic boutiques. And for commuters, easy access to the Sprinter light rail makes getting to nearby areas a cinch, enhancing the appeal for those working in the greater San Diego region.

Buying Tips
When searching for a condo in San Marcos, prioritize whatβs most important to you. Are you keen on proximity to schools like San Marcos High School, or do you prefer easy access to transit stops? Consider spending a weekend exploring neighborhoods like Discovery Hills and the University District to get a feel for the community. Don't shy away from asking about homeowners association fees; they can vary widely and may impact your budget. Finally, make sure to check out local events and community gatherings; they can give you insights into the neighborhood's culture and help you envision your life there.
